Grading and Attendance Policies

Multimedia: (two weighted catagories)

Projects and Daily Assignments--90%
Daily assignments are those smaller assignments that students complete while we are learning the different multimedia elements. These are generally graded using a checksheet and are usually worth between 10 and 20 points each.
Projects are completed at the end of each unit of learning. They are graded with a rubric that is available on the class moodle site. These usually take several days to complete and are usually worth 40-80 points.

Work Habits--10%
Each student begins with the total 100 points in this category. Students lose points for the following:
Missing class unexcused...-10 points
Coming late to class unexcused...-5 points
Wasting class work time...-5 points
Inappropriate internet use...-10 points
Texting in class...-10 points
Disrespectful to others...-10 points
**all Work Habit points lost can be made up

I use the traditional 90-80-70-60 grade scale.

Microsoft Office : (three weighted catagories)

Chapter Projects and Blogs--60%
Projects are completed at the end of each chapter/lesson. Many keys are available online, so students should be able to complete the work correctly. Blogs are graded on ideas, organization, and writing mechanics. Blogs are worth 10 points each with each individual chapter project worth five points each.

Review Projects --30%
At the end of each unit, there are review projects. These review projects will be graded uning a checklist rubric which will be available on the moodle site.

CDC Attendance Policy-Per Semester

School Related Absences--any missed classthat is verified to be related to school activities will not count as an absence. Work missed is still required to be made up.

5 Absences Rule--a student who has five absences in a semester can have credit reduced by 1/2 of the assigned credit for the class.

10 Absences Rule--a student who has ten absences in a semester will be dropped from the class and receive a WF.
*a maximum of three absences can be made up at the teacher's discretion
